Make a frame for the floor out of two 2x4s, allowing for 3 feet of storage. To create a level floor, cover the frame with plywood. To enable access to the underfloor storage, cut holes and add doors in the plywood down the center of the tube. Add bunk beds and the comforts of home. biogene cleaning companyWebMay 22, 2013 · The people at www.utahsheltersystems.com turn culvert pipe into fallout shelters with air filtration and blast doors.
